Palouse Federated Church is an interdenominational Christian church born out of the coming together of the Methodist, Baptist and Presbyterian churches of Palouse, WA. Respect for people from other Christian traditions has been a hallmark of our community since our founding and remains an important part of who we are today. At Palouse Federated Church, you will find, diversity and respect, coupled with the hospitality and kindness of our small town.

In this special edition of the Church on a Hill Podcast, Pastor Corey and Tim discuss the Dark Side of the Christmas story. When Jesus arrived on the scene it wasn't all angels and singing - there were cries of pain and distress, great fear, and the key characters fled for their lives. It was a Perfectly [Imperfect] Christmas.
At this time of year, some people don't feel very merry and it's difficult to insert themselves into the fun and frivolity of the season when, often times, they feel grief, deep loneliness, despair and sadness. But the reason God entered into our broken world in the baby Jesus was to make us whole and bring us everlasting peace. Jesus is the Light of the World and in him there is hope for us all. Listen to this encouraging discussion about the challenges of the season and the hope we all have in Jesus.
